restricted views
[rɪˈstrɪktɪd vjuːz]
noun
visões restritas
1. Limited or obstructed sightlines, particularly in venues like theaters, stadiums, or arenas where certain seats have partially blocked views of the stage or playing field
The cheaper tickets were for seats with restricted views of the stage.
Os ingressos mais baratos eram para assentos com visões restritas do palco.
2. A narrow or limited perspective on a subject, issue, or situation
The committee's restricted views on the matter prevented innovation.
As visões restritas do comitê sobre o assunto impediram a inovação.
3. Information or content that has access limitations or confidentiality constraints
The document contains restricted views that only authorized personnel can access.
O documento contém visões restritas que apenas pessoal autorizado pode acessar.
In American culture, 'restricted views' commonly refers to discounted theater or sports tickets with obstructed sightlines. In Brazilian Portuguese, while 'visões restritas' is understood, the term more frequently appears in business, technology, and academic contexts relating to access control or limited perspectives. The term gained prominence in digital contexts with the rise of user permission settings and information access restrictions.
